Buda is a charming city located in Hays County, Texas, United States of America. Nestled in the heart of Texas Hill Country, Buda offers a peaceful and relaxed atmosphere combined with a close proximity to the vibrant city of Austin.
The best time to visit Buda is during the spring and fall seasons when the weather is mild and pleasant. Springtime is especially beautiful with blooming wildflowers and picturesque landscapes. However, Buda's charming ambiance and attractions can be enjoyed year-round.
There are several reasons to visit Buda. Firstly, it is a great destination for outdoor enthusiasts, with numerous parks and natural areas to explore, including the beautiful Historic Stagecoach Park and the scenic Onion Creek Greenbelt. Buda is also known for its rich history and heritage, with several historic sites and museums to discover, such as the Buda Mill & Grain Co., which tells the story of the city's agricultural past. Moreover, Buda hosts various lively festivals throughout the year, including the Buda Wiener Dog Races and the Buda Fine Arts Festival, providing visitors with unique cultural experiences.
